Improved Epstein-Glaser renormalization in coordinate space I. Euclidean framework
Abstract
In a series of papers, we investigate the reformulation of Epstein-Glaser renormalization in coordinate space, both in analytic and Hopf algebraic terms. This first article deals with analytical aspects. Some of the historically good reasons for the divorces of the Epstein-Glaser method, both from mainstream quantum field theory and the mathematical literature on distributions, are made plain; and overcome.
